Going updates Following 8mm of rain overnight, the ground at the Curragh is soft on the straight course and yielding to soft on the round course for today's eight-race card which gets under way at 1.25pm. A mainly dry day is forecast and they're racing on the stands' side today with the stalls in the centre for all sprints. It's also set to be mainly dry for the National Hunt card at Fairyhouse. The ground remains good, good to yielding in places and the first of seven races is off at 2.10pm. The ground is soft at Killarney ahead of Monday's additional Flat meeting. After a mainly dry day today, up to 15mm (approx) of rain is forecast for tomorrow with mainly dry conditions thereafter.
